From my understanding, yes, this charger can be used to charge this battery. The key is that you are charging a deep cycle battery so ensure that you are charging using the deep cycle setting. Secondly, with deep cycle batteries, you should use a very slow rate of charging or trickle charging so use the 2 Amp setting. Never charge a deep cycle battery using higher current levels to reduce charging time as the bateries are not manufactured to take charge on quickly like a regular automotive battery.
Secondly, pay careful attention to your battery when charging in this manner as with any charger on a trickle charge setting, (except with a professional grade battery maintainer), the battery will accept a great deal more charge at these low settings and for these extended charging periods. Therefore, it is imperative that you calculate the charge time based on the depletion of the battery plus the 25% overage factor, (see the manual that came with the charger for this calculation), and stick to this charge time to ensure you do not overcharge the battery.
Lastly, ensure you adhere to all of the appropriate safe charging steps, (ie: proper ventilation, no sparks or arcing and keeping the charger a safe distance from the battery during charging).
You should have no problems if you follow these steps.
